To add some light and shade to this discussion somewhat, using Anthony Koutoufides in 2004 as a little bit of a benchmark about what the norm was for an AFL player then, you quickly see that players get much more of the footy these days and the statistical comparison doesnt quite add up.

Where Cripps and Murphy are seeing the ball 35+ times, Kouta was having his best games getting close to 30 touches and his poorer games his stats were in the teens and it might be fair to say that the playing field is not quite comparable between them and leave that as a footnote to the discussion with the only conclusion being that currently, Cameron Polson is yet to stamp his AFL credentials and that he has another season or two to do so.
